#include <linux/types.h>
Go to the source code of this file.
|
Definition at line 280 of file rc_types.h. |
|
Definition at line 282 of file rc_types.h. |
|
Definition at line 283 of file rc_types.h. |
|
Definition at line 281 of file rc_types.h. Referenced by rsbac_adf_set_attr_rc(). |
|
Definition at line 284 of file rc_types.h. Referenced by rsbac_adf_set_attr_rc(). |
|
Definition at line 274 of file rc_types.h. Referenced by get_attr_fd(), and rsbac_adf_set_attr_rc(). |
|
Definition at line 273 of file rc_types.h. Referenced by rsbac_adf_set_attr_rc(). |
|
Definition at line 275 of file rc_types.h. Referenced by rsbac_adf_set_attr_rc(). |
|
Definition at line 272 of file rc_types.h. Referenced by rsbac_adf_request_rc(), rsbac_adf_set_attr_rc(), and rsbac_rc_test_assign_roles(). |
|
|
Definition at line 277 of file rc_types.h. Referenced by rsbac_adf_set_attr_rc(). |
|
Definition at line 276 of file rc_types.h. Referenced by rsbac_adf_set_attr_rc(). |
|
Definition at line 264 of file rc_types.h. Referenced by get_attr_dev(), get_attr_fd(), register_dev_lists(), rsbac_adf_request_rc(), and rsbac_adf_set_attr_rc(). |
|
Definition at line 263 of file rc_types.h. Referenced by rsbac_adf_request_rc(), and rsbac_adf_set_attr_rc(). |
|
Definition at line 270 of file rc_types.h. Referenced by rsbac_rc_check_type_comp(), rsbac_rc_copy_type(), rsbac_rc_get_item(), rsbac_rc_set_item(), set_attr_dev(), and sys_rsbac_rc_copy_type(). |
|
Definition at line 269 of file rc_types.h. Referenced by rsbac_rc_set_item(). |
|
Definition at line 268 of file rc_types.h. Referenced by rsbac_adf_request_rc(), and rsbac_adf_set_attr_rc(). |
|
Definition at line 265 of file rc_types.h. Referenced by rsbac_adf_request_rc(), and rsbac_adf_set_attr_rc(). |
|
Definition at line 266 of file rc_types.h. Referenced by rsbac_adf_request_rc(), and rsbac_adf_set_attr_rc(). |
|
Definition at line 267 of file rc_types.h. Referenced by rsbac_adf_request_rc(), and rsbac_adf_set_attr_rc(). |
|
Definition at line 27 of file rc_types.h. |
|
Definition at line 61 of file rc_types.h. |
|
Value: { \ 0, \ 0, \ 0, \ 0, \ 0, \ /* ST_rlimit */ RSBAC_REQUEST_VECTOR(GET_STATUS_DATA) | RSBAC_REQUEST_VECTOR(MODIFY_SYSTEM_DATA), \ /* ST_swap */ 0, \ /* ST_syslog */ 0, \ /* ST_rsbac */ 0, \ /* ST_rsbac_log */ ((rsbac_request_vector_t) 1 << R_GET_STATUS_DATA) | ((rsbac_request_vector_t) 1 << R_MODIFY_SYSTEM_DATA), \ /* ST_other */ ( \ ((rsbac_request_vector_t) 1 << R_MAP_EXEC) \ ), \ /* ST_kmem */ 0, \ /* ST_network */ ((rsbac_request_vector_t) 1 << R_GET_STATUS_DATA), \ /* ST_firewall */ 0, \ /* ST_priority */ 0, \ /* 15 = ST_none */ 0 \ } Definition at line 240 of file rc_types.h. |
|
Definition at line 19 of file rc_types.h. Referenced by rsbac_init_rc(). |
|
Definition at line 20 of file rc_types.h. Referenced by rsbac_init_rc(). |
|
Definition at line 70 of file rc_types.h. Referenced by rsbac_init_rc(), and rsbac_rc_get_item(). |
|
Definition at line 72 of file rc_types.h. |
|
Value: { \ 0, \ 0, \ 0, \ 0, \ 0, \ /* ST_rlimit */ RSBAC_REQUEST_VECTOR(GET_STATUS_DATA) | RSBAC_REQUEST_VECTOR(MODIFY_SYSTEM_DATA), \ /* ST_swap */ 0, \ /* ST_syslog */ 0, \ /* ST_rsbac */ 0, \ /* ST_rsbac_log */ 0, \ /* ST_other */ ( \ ((rsbac_request_vector_t) 1 << R_MAP_EXEC) \ ), \ /* ST_kmem */ 0, \ /* ST_network */ ((rsbac_request_vector_t) 1 << R_GET_STATUS_DATA), \ /* ST_firewall */ 0, \ /* ST_priority */ 0, \ /* 15 = ST_none */ 0 \ } Definition at line 109 of file rc_types.h. |
|
Definition at line 16 of file rc_types.h. Referenced by rsbac_adf_set_attr_rc(), rsbac_init(), and rsbac_init_rc(). |
|
Definition at line 21 of file rc_types.h. Referenced by get_attr_dev(), get_attr_ipc(), register_dev_lists(), register_ipc_lists(), rsbac_adf_request_rc(), rsbac_adf_set_attr_rc(), and rsbac_init_rc(). |
|
Definition at line 24 of file rc_types.h. Referenced by rsbac_adf_set_attr_rc(). |
|
Definition at line 26 of file rc_types.h. Referenced by rsbac_init_rc(), rsbac_rc_copy_type(), rsbac_rc_get_item(), and rsbac_rc_set_item(). |
|
Definition at line 29 of file rc_types.h. |
|
Value: (RSBAC_PROCESS_REQUEST_VECTOR | \ RSBAC_RC_RIGHTS_VECTOR(R_CONNECT) | \ RSBAC_RC_RIGHTS_VECTOR(R_ACCEPT) | \ RSBAC_RC_RIGHTS_VECTOR(R_SEND) | \ RSBAC_RC_RIGHTS_VECTOR(R_RECEIVE) \ ) Definition at line 63 of file rc_types.h. |
|
Definition at line 45 of file rc_types.h. Referenced by rsbac_init_rc(), rsbac_rc_check_comp(), and rsbac_rc_sys_set_item(). |
|
Definition at line 17 of file rc_types.h. Referenced by rsbac_init_rc(). |
|
Definition at line 46 of file rc_types.h. |
|
Definition at line 131 of file rc_types.h. |
|
Definition at line 22 of file rc_types.h. Referenced by rsbac_init_rc(). |
|
Definition at line 30 of file rc_types.h. Referenced by get_rc_special_right_name(), and get_rc_special_right_nr(). |
|
Value: (\ RSBAC_RC_RIGHTS_VECTOR(RCR_ADMIN) | \ RSBAC_RC_RIGHTS_VECTOR(RCR_ASSIGN) | \ RSBAC_RC_RIGHTS_VECTOR(RCR_ACCESS_CONTROL) | \ RSBAC_RC_RIGHTS_VECTOR(RCR_SUPERVISOR) | \ RSBAC_RC_RIGHTS_VECTOR(RCR_MODIFY_AUTH) \ ) Definition at line 49 of file rc_types.h. Referenced by rsbac_init_rc(), and rsbac_rc_sys_set_item(). |
|
Value: (\ RSBAC_RC_RIGHTS_VECTOR(RCR_SUPERVISOR) | \ ) Definition at line 57 of file rc_types.h. |
|
Definition at line 23 of file rc_types.h. Referenced by rsbac_init_rc(). |
|
Definition at line 174 of file rc_types.h. |
|
Definition at line 18 of file rc_types.h. Referenced by rsbac_init_rc(). |
|
Definition at line 47 of file rc_types.h. |
|
Definition at line 84 of file rc_types.h. Referenced by get_rc_scd_type_name(), get_rc_scd_type_nr(), and rsbac_rc_set_item(). |
|
Definition at line 76 of file rc_types.h. |
|
Definition at line 40 of file rc_types.h. |
|
Definition at line 74 of file rc_types.h. |
|
Definition at line 43 of file rc_types.h. |
|
Definition at line 75 of file rc_types.h. |
|
Definition at line 78 of file rc_types.h. 00078 {RC_no_admin, RC_role_admin, RC_system_admin, RC_none};
|
|
Definition at line 298 of file rc_types.h. 00298 { RI_role_comp, 00299 RI_admin_roles, 00300 RI_assign_roles, 00301 RI_type_comp_fd, 00302 RI_type_comp_dev, 00303 RI_type_comp_user, 00304 RI_type_comp_process, 00305 RI_type_comp_ipc, 00306 RI_type_comp_scd, 00307 RI_type_comp_group, 00308 RI_type_comp_netdev, 00309 RI_type_comp_nettemp, 00310 RI_type_comp_netobj, 00311 RI_admin_type, 00312 RI_name, 00313 RI_def_fd_create_type, 00314 RI_def_fd_ind_create_type, 00315 RI_def_user_create_type, 00316 RI_def_process_create_type, 00317 RI_def_process_chown_type, 00318 RI_def_process_execute_type, 00319 RI_def_ipc_create_type, 00320 RI_def_group_create_type, 00321 RI_boot_role, 00322 RI_type_fd_name, 00323 RI_type_dev_name, 00324 RI_type_ipc_name, 00325 RI_type_user_name, 00326 RI_type_process_name, 00327 RI_type_group_name, 00328 RI_type_netdev_name, 00329 RI_type_nettemp_name, 00330 RI_type_netobj_name, 00331 RI_type_fd_need_secdel, 00332 RI_type_scd_name, /* Pseudo, using get_rc_scd_name() */ 00333 RI_remove_role, 00334 RI_def_fd_ind_create_type_remove, 00335 RI_type_fd_remove, 00336 RI_type_dev_remove, 00337 RI_type_ipc_remove, 00338 RI_type_user_remove, 00339 RI_type_process_remove, 00340 RI_type_group_remove, 00341 RI_type_netdev_remove, 00342 RI_type_nettemp_remove, 00343 RI_type_netobj_remove, 00344 #ifdef __KERNEL__ 00345 #endif 00346 RI_none};
|
|
Definition at line 85 of file rc_types.h. 00085 {RST_auth_administration = RST_min, 00086 RST_none};
|
|
Definition at line 32 of file rc_types.h. 00033 { RCR_ADMIN = RSBAC_RC_SPECIAL_RIGHT_BASE, 00034 RCR_ASSIGN, 00035 RCR_ACCESS_CONTROL, 00036 RCR_SUPERVISOR, 00037 RCR_MODIFY_AUTH, 00038 RCR_NONE};
|
|
Definition at line 290 of file rc_types.h.
|